#46324e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#46324e is composed of 27.5% red, 19.6%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.3% cyan, 35.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 282.9 degrees, a saturation of 21.9% and a lightness of 25.1%. #46324e color hex could be obtained by blending #8c649c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#46324e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#46324e has RGB values of R:70, G:50,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 4600398.
